Post by Bartolomeo on Jul 17, 2015 16:46:14 GMT
I think this will encourage a grittier form of RP, causing a sense of desperation. No longer will there be the sunshine, lollipops and rainbows of the old server were everyone was financially well off. We might actually see beggars in the streets, and more people will take up petty thievery. Buying a shirt will be a chore, just like working up to get that full tin in a normal PW server. If anything, I think it will ENCOURAGE financial gain through RP. No stockpiles means that the farmer has to sell his crop to the lord, no stockpiles means the blacksmith has to negotiate a price for his sword. I think some FUCKING AWESOME RP will come from this change.
Dunno, just my thoughts.

Post by lavulpe on Jul 17, 2015 21:49:34 GMT
You are bickering over a point that has been proven to work, enjoyed by all (including the poor), has made magnificent RP, involving the poor, and more importantly, a point that is staying whether you fight over it or not. Let me set some points of what to expect. If you are planning to get in a fight daily, you will not enjoy this. You MIGHT get a single fight in a week. That is because people do not want to die, they would rather rp. If you expect to have armor and weapons in a short amount of time,you will hate this. Odds are your character will die before he can be clothed in mail with decent weapons. This is realistic and people enjoy it as well. Most soldiers will be equipped with fairly basic weapons and cloth armor. On ToR having leather was a priveledge few could afford. Only 2-3 people had studded leather, and that was a sign of having plenty of coin. If you want something, you will have to work for it. And you will need to build a reputation or people will not hire you. I made a mercenary char on ToR to test this, it took me a week of begging for a job to get a short spear, and another week to get a red gambeson. And I enjoyed those two weeks, my char made good friends and after a month most people, and every noble, knew who he was. After that his career took off, and that is how life works. A slow start followed by a rocket to the top of done right.
Crazed, your characters will have to experience actual work for the first time ever. I hope you have the patience for it.
